   Echo Chain Saw


22 Feb 2008 09:12:06
| Mike Yeager


Chain saws come in many shapes and sizes, and echo chain saw is one of the more powerful chain saw in the Echo family. Generally used for more heavy-duty work like feeling large trees, it can be utilized for other matters limited only by your imagination. For example, you can clear underbrush around your property. It has a two-stroke engine and vibration reduction mechanism that are built into the system. This powerful echo chain saw is easy to use, with reduced need for employing excessive muscular power. The starting process is easy, and the echo chain saw is smooth running and definitely appealing.

After the purchase of an echo chain saw, one might want to keep the model number in mind. If some thing were to go wrong instead of buying an entirely new machine you could just replace the parts that have worn out. In most cases this works well to extend the life of a machine, and sustains the performance levels. Dealers are available who offer parts for the echo chain saw. If you know the model number all you have to do is get hold of a dealer manual and voila, you have access to all the chainsaw parts that you could possibly want.

An Echo chain saw is a solid piece of machinery. With proper care and maintenance it will provide years and years of solid performance. Whether you’re clearing large trees from a tract of land, or trimming up some dead-wood for firewood you’ll be satisfied knowing you can rely on an Echo chain saw.
